PHYSICIANS IN CHICAGO

WHO ARE IN GOOD AND REGULAR STANDING ACCORDING TO

THE CODE OF ETHICS OF THE AMERICAN

MEDICAL ASSOCIATION.

"

Any physician who shall by any advertisement, placard, handbill, circular, pamphlet, book, card, or any public means, announce himself or herself as possessing unusual or peculiar skill in any branch of medicine or surgery, or who shall assume any title not specially granted by a regularly chartered college, shall not be eligible to membership in this society; and the name of such physician shall not be permitted to appear in the list of regular physicians published in the Chicago Medical Register; Provided, that a physician may be permitted to affix or connect with his or her name the title or designation of a specialty when he or she shall have ceased to do any practice not pertaining to such specialty, and not otherwise, but the language of such designation shall always state this fact, and (13)

shall be in style thus: 'Surgery only,' or 'Exclusive attention

given to

diseases.'"-Resolution adopted by the Chicago

Medico-Historical Society, August 2, 1874.
